About The Position

The Cross-Platform team at ByteDance is responsible for developing a high-performance rendering engine and a versatile application framework used across a wide range of products. These systems enable efficient, consistent, and high-quality UI development at scale. We are expanding our mission to improve developer experience and efficiency by building intelligent development tools. These tools will assist engineers working on complex cross-platform systems-streamlining workflows, surfacing insights, and reducing development friction through the integration of AI and automation. We are seeking an experienced AI Developer to join our team in building the next generation of internal development tools. Your work will focus on integrating AI and machine learning into our toolchain to accelerate software development, improve code quality, and simplify engineering workflows.

Responsibilities

  • Design and implement AI-powered developer infrastructure that enhances productivity, reduces friction, and improves code quality.
  • Build and refine intelligent systems for knowledge management, including vector databases, retrieval-augmented generation (RAG) pipelines, BM25-based retrieval, and named entity recognition.
  • Develop and integrate coding agent tools (similar to Codex-, Claude-, or Gemini-style assistants) to support tasks such as code generation, diagnostics, refactoring, and performance tuning.
  • Create and maintain evaluation frameworks and benchmarks (e.g., custom test suites like SWE-bench variants) to rigorously assess AI systems on real-world coding tasks.
  • Collaborate with engineers across frameworks and rendering domains to understand pain points and translate them into practical, AI-enhanced solutions.
  • Maintain infrastructure for model integration including code analysis, in-editor assistance, and workflow automation.
  • Track emerging trends in AI-assisted development and propose new tools and features that push the boundaries of developer experience.
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service